LibriVox recording of Faraday As A Discoverer by John Tyndall. Read in English by William Allan Jones; realisticspeakers; Michele Fry; Owlivia; KevinS; Alan Mapstone; Christina Fu; Jeremy Clark; Wayne Cooke This is the first of two related Faraday projects. It is about Faraday and deals more with biographical references to Faraday, outlining the important junctures in his life. The second, On the Various Forces of Nature , consists of lectures by Faraday covering a non-mathematical survey of the fundamental forces of nature and some relationships among them.
